2021 Toyota 4Runner and 2007 Lincoln Navigator Specifications

Model Year 2021 2007  
Model Toyota 4Runner Lincoln Navigator  
Engine 4.0L V6
DOHC-4v
270 hp@5600
278 lb-ft@4400
5.4L V8
OHC-3v
300 hp@5000
365 lb-ft@3750
 
Transmission 5-speed shiftable automatic 6-speed automatic  
Drivetrain 4WD w/low range 4WD  
Body 4dr SUV 4dr SUV  
      Difference
Wheelbase 109.8 in 119.0 in -9.2 in
Length 190.2 in 208.4 in -18.2 in
Width 75.8 in 78.8 in -3 in
Height 71.5 in 77.8 in -6.3 in
Curb Weight 4805 lb. 6059 lb. -1254 lb.
Fuel Capacity 23.0 gal. 28.0 gal. -5 gal.
Headroom, Row 1 39.3 in 39.5 in -0.2 in
Shoulder Room, Row 1 57.8 in 63.3 in -5.5 in
Hip Room, Row 1 56.5 in 60.2 in -3.7 in
Legroom, Row 1 41.7 in 41.1 in 0.6 in
Headroom, Row 2 38.6 in 39.7 in -1.1 in
Shoulder Room, Row 2 57.8 in 63.7 in -5.9 in
Hip Room, Row 2 55.7 in 59.9 in -4.2 in
Legroom, Row 2 32.9 in 39.1 in -6.2 in
Headroom, Row 3 34.3 in 37.5 in -3.2 in
Shoulder Room, Row 3 57.7 in 51.9 in 5.8 in
Hip Room, Row 3 43.3 in 50.1 in -6.8 in
Legroom, Row 3 29.3 in 37.7 in -8.4 in
Total Legroom 103.9 in (over 3 rows) 117.9 in (over 3 rows) -14 in
Cargo Volume, Minimum 9.0 ft3 18.1 ft3 -9.1 ft3
Cargo Volume, Behind R2 46.3 ft3 54.4 ft3 -8.1 ft3
Cargo Volume, Maximum 88.8 ft3 103.3 ft3 -14.5 ft3
